Course Goal / Objective

The aim of this course is to equip students with the ability to reduce waste, increase efficiency, and improve processes in textile production systems. Students will learn lean production tools and be able to apply them in real manufacturing environments.

Course Content

This course covers the fundamental principles and practical tools of lean manufacturing aimed at improving efficiency and reducing waste in textile production processes. It introduces the role and importance of lean thinking in the textile industry. Students learn to distinguish between value-added and non-value-added activities, analyze types of waste, and apply process improvement techniques. Key lean tools such as 5S, Kaizen, Kanban, Value Stream Mapping (VSM), SMED, and Poka-Yoke are covered both theoretically and through practical applications. In addition, process analysis, workflow optimization, productivity measurement, and continuous improvement practices in textile production lines are examined through case studies. The course aims to equip students with problem-solving and improvement proposal skills in real or simulated production environments.

Course Learning Outcomes

Order Course Learning Outcomes
LO01 Explain the fundamental principles of lean manufacturing philosophy.
LO02 Identify types of waste in textile production processes.
LO03 Distinguish between value-added and non-value-added activities.
LO04 Perform process analysis using Value Stream Mapping (VSM).
LO05 Apply the 5S system in a production environment.
LO06 Develop continuous improvement suggestions using the Kaizen approach.
LO07 Explain the basic functioning of the Kanban system.
LO08 Interpret and apply lean techniques such as SMED and Poka-Yoke.
LO09 Analyze efficiency and performance in textile production processes.
LO10 Develop improvement proposals for production processes.
